Graduate Resident Assistant in Sport
Posted 6 hours 42 minutes ago by Coast and Vale Learning Trust
Fixed-Term Contract from 26 August 2026 until 25 August 2027. Full-time Term-time (34 weeks per year) Includes full board and accommodation.
Each year, Felsted School appoints graduates to support departments in the delivery of our programmes, and to contribute to co-curricular activities, boarding and house duties across the School.
Our sports graduates assist in our physical education and sports programmes with supervising, coaching, refereeing, umpiring and the organising of major games and activities at our Prep and Senior Schools.
Felsted School has a comprehensive training programme and fixture lists which includes supervising, coaching, refereeing, umpiring and supporting major games and activities. The main fixture sports at the School are rugby, netball, hockey, cricket, tennis, and football. The programme also includes swimming, squash, badminton, running, fitness, and dance. Pupils have PE lessons from Reception through to Year 11. Pupils can select PE as a GCSE option. In the Sixth Form, pupils can take the subject as PE A Level, Sport BTEC, or Sports Science via the IB route.
We are looking for enthusiastic individuals who are passionate about sport. It is essential applicants are able to communicate effectively with young people as the role will include covering sports lessons and the possibility of accompanying sports trips. It is vital candidates have an evident passion for sport and games together with a strong interest in the teaching and the learning process, including high expectations of all students.
We particularly welcome applications from those who are able to coach more than one major sport and willing to assist in all areas of school life.
Full board and accommodation will be provided plus an honorarium payment of £16,730.17 per annum. This is a fixed-term position commencing from 26 August 2026 until 25 August 2027 and would be an ideal role for someone who holds a degree in Sport and is considering a career in teaching or boarding education.
Benefits include free life assurance and parking, contributory pension scheme, unlimited use of the Felsted Gym and pool facilities, on-site Coffee Shop and membership to Felsted Connect; an online multi-platform engagement tool where employees have access to hundreds of exclusive discounts and offers from online and high-street retailers.
